This paint is ideal for exterior metal and wood surfaces, such as doors, window frames, garden gates, and railings.
You can recoat Dulux Weathershield Exterior Satinwood after approximately 6 hours, depending on temperature and humidity conditions.
As this is a water-based paint, you can easily clean your brushes and other equipment with clean water immediately after use.
Yes, it is made with protective technology designed to resist mould and cracking, providing a durable and long-lasting finish.
This paint contains minimal VOCs (Volatile Organic Compounds), meaning it has a lower odour compared to traditional solvent-based paints and is a safer choice for your home and the environment.
For best results, especially on bare wood, bare metal, or previously painted surfaces that are in poor condition, it is recommended to use a suitable Dulux primer or undercoat to ensure maximum adhesion and a smooth finish.
Ensure ambient temperature and humidity are within recommended ranges for painting (typically above 10°C and low humidity). Apply thin, even coats; thick coats will take longer to dry. Good ventilation can also aid drying.
Ensure the surface was thoroughly prepared and clean before painting. Apply the paint evenly, following the grain of the wood. Use a good quality brush and avoid over-brushing. An additional thin, even coat may resolve minor streaks.
Ensure the surface was properly primed, especially if it was a dark or porous substrate. Apply the paint at the recommended spreading rate, ensuring sufficient product on the brush. Allow the first coat to dry completely for 6 hours before applying a second coat. Most exterior paints benefit from two coats for optimal colour and durability.
